Cataract surgery, additionally called lens substitute surgical procedure, is a treatment to replace the natural lens in the eye. The procedure eliminates the opacified all-natural lens and changes it with an intraocular lens. It is a common procedure for individuals that experience a problem called cataract. It does have some threats and also side effects, yet it is risk-free for the majority of people.
Cataract surgery is a reasonably uncomplicated procedure that typically takes less than an hour. The specialist makes a small incision in the eye, breaks up the cataract, as well as inserts a new lens. There are no stitches after cataract surgical procedure, as well as the lacerations will shut naturally over time. Patients usually wear a safety shield during the treatment.

The recovery time after cataract surgical procedure is around one month. You might experience light pain or rips for a couple of days adhering to surgical treatment. To lessen swelling as well as infection, the healthcare provider will prescribe eye drops to help in reducing discomfort. You will likewise be encouraged not to drive for a couple of days complying with the procedure. Additionally, wearing sunglasses is a great concept. Last but not least, stay clear of getting anything right into your eye or touching it for a few days following surgical procedure.

During cataract surgical procedure, your medical professional will use an ultrasound machine to examine the health of your eye as well as identify what man-made lens to use. The treatment is typically done in an outpatient clinic or medical facility. You will not require to stay overnight, yet you'll require someone to drive you residence later. Prior to surgical procedure, your medical professional will numb the eye with a medication to ensure that you will not feel any kind of discomfort. You'll possibly additionally be offered medicines to relax you before surgical procedure.

After the surgical treatment, you will certainly need to follow up visits with your cosmetic surgeon. You'll be needed to have a follow-up eye exam and also will be recommended new spectacles. Many patients can return to light responsibility within 2 to 3 days. As a whole, complete recovery from cataract surgical procedure can extract from one to two months. This period is needed for your eye to adapt to the new lens.
